<div class="feature-browser">\r
<h4>Feature Browser</h4>\r
<div class="option">\r
- <span class="link"><a href="FeaturesApplication?renderingMode=detect">Autodetected mode</a></span>\r
- <span class="desc">Use AJAX if supported by browser, otherwise fallback to HTML mode</span>\r
- </div>\r
- <div class="option">\r
- <span class="link"><a href="FeaturesApplication?renderingMode=ajax">AJAX mode</a></span>\r
- <span class="desc">Select AJAX-based technology mode</span>\r
- </div>\r
- <div class="option">\r
- <span class="link"><a href="FeaturesApplication?renderingMode=html">HTML mode</a></span>\r
- <span class="desc">Select page based request/response technology mode</span>\r
+ <span class="link"><a href="FeaturesApplication/">FeatureBrowser</a></span>\r
+ <span class="desc">Test bench application for trying out different components and features of the IT Mill Toolkit</span>\r
</div>\r
<br />Source code:\r
<span class="link"><a href="src/com/itmill/toolkit/demo/features">browse features folder</a></span>\r
<div class="sample-code">\r
<h3>Simple application demos</h3>\r
<div class="option">\r
- <span class="link"><a href="HelloWorld?renderingMode=ajax">HelloWorld</a></span>\r
+ <span class="link"><a href="HelloWorld/">HelloWorld</a></span>\r
<span class="desc">Simple Toolkit application.</span>\r
</div>\r
<div class="option">\r
- <span class="link"><a href="Calc?renderingMode=ajax">Calc</a></span>\r
+ <span class="link"><a href="Calc/">Calc</a></span>\r
<span class="desc">Simple Toolkit application where events are used.</span>\r
</div>\r
<br />Source code:\r
</div>\r
\r
<div class="sample-code">\r
- <h3><a href="UpgradingSample?renderingMode=ajax">Long lifecycle of Toolkit applications</a></h3>\r
+ <h3><a href="UpgradingSample/">Long lifecycle of Toolkit applications</a></h3>\r
<div class="option">\r
<p>\r
Demonstrates sample <a href="http://www.millstone.org/">Millstone</a> application that was ajaxified (upgraded to Toolkit 4.0.0)\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="LayoutDemo?renderingMode=ajax">Layout demo</a></h3>\r
+ <h3><a href="LayoutDemo/">Layout demo</a></h3>\r
<div class="option">\r
<p>\r
This example demonstrates layouts for Tookit application.\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="CustomLayoutDemo?renderingMode=ajax">Custom layout and custom theme demo</a></h3>\r
+ <h3><a href="CustomLayoutDemo/">Custom layout and custom theme demo</a></h3>\r
<div class="option">\r
<p>\r
This example demonstrates how Toolkit interacts with HTML pages\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="QueryContainerDemo?renderingMode=ajax">Tree using QueryContainer demo</a></h3>\r
+ <h3><a href="QueryContainerDemo/">Tree using QueryContainer demo</a></h3>\r
<div class="option">\r
<p>\r
This example shows how Table, Select and Tree UI components can use Containers. \r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="TableDemo?renderingMode=ajax">Table demo</a></h3>\r
+ <h3><a href="TableDemo/">Table demo</a></h3>\r
<div class="option">\r
<p>\r
Similar to <em>Tree using QueryContainer demo</em> but uses different style\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="TreeFilesystemContainer?renderingMode=ajax">Tree using FilesystemContainer demo</a></h3>\r
+ <h3><a href="TreeFilesystemContainer/">Tree using FilesystemContainer demo</a></h3>\r
<div class="option">\r
<p>\r
Browsable file explorer using Toolkit Tree component.\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="TreeFilesystem?renderingMode=ajax">Tree item handling demo</a></h3>\r
+ <h3><a href="TreeFilesystem/">Tree item handling demo</a></h3>\r
<div class="option">\r
<p>\r
Browsable file explorer using Toolkit Tree component.\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="SelectDemo?renderingMode=ajax">Select demo</a></h3>\r
+ <h3><a href="SelectDemo/">Select demo</a></h3>\r
<div class="option">\r
<p>\r
This example shows select component with default and lazy loading functionality enabled (a.k.a Google Suggest).\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="FilterSelect?renderingMode=ajax">FilterSelect demo</a></h3>\r
+ <h3><a href="FilterSelect/">FilterSelect demo</a></h3>\r
<div class="option">\r
<p>\r
This example shows three select components with lazy loading functionality enabled.\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="ModalWindow?renderingMode=ajax">Modal window</a></h3>\r
+ <h3><a href="ModalWindow/">Modal window</a></h3>\r
<div class="option">\r
Example of how Modal Windows may be created using Window component.\r
</div>\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="KeyboardShortcut?renderingMode=ajax">Keyboard events demo</a></h3>\r
+ <h3><a href="KeyboardShortcut/">Keyboard events demo</a></h3>\r
<div class="option">\r
Contains few Toolkit UI components that can be interacted by pressing keys in keyboard.\r
<b>Note</b>: This feature is under development and is considered as beta.\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="Parameters?renderingMode=ajax">URI and Parameter handling demo</a></h3>\r
+ <h3><a href="Parameters/">URI and Parameter handling demo</a></h3>\r
<div class="option">\r
This is a demonstration of how URL parameters can be received and handled.\r
Parameters and URL:s can be received trough the windows by registering\r
</div>\r
\r
<div class="feature-browser">\r
- <h3><a href="BufferedComponents?renderingMode=ajax">Buffered UI components demo</a></h3>\r
+ <h3><a href="BufferedComponents/">Buffered UI components demo</a></h3>\r
<div class="option">\r
Explains how to use buffering with UI components, and how to perform commit and discard functions.\r
With buffered UI components underlying data objects and UI objects have separate states.\r